This resource for designing and conducting a rapid qualitative assessment is available from partners in the NTD area, but it can apply to any health area using campaigns.
This guide addresses one critical gap of the availability of resources to support the use of qualitative methods to strengthen MDA through a six step process. It aims to facilitate adaptive program learning for MDA by providing guidance on qualitative study design, implementationImplementation aims to develop strategies for available or new health interventions in order to improve access to, and the use of, these, analysis, and prioritization of recommendations, while also triangulating findings with existing knowledge. The main document takes the reader through the six steps and contains links to the relevant annexes for each step of the process.
